Optimization of a Rectangular Warehouse Design Using Heuristics Techniques
摘要
This research aims to determine the number of cross aisles that minimizes distance traveled. To achieve this, a rectangular warehouse with various transverse aisles was defined, and simulations were conducted with 0 to 90 transverse aisles using heuristic algorithms (FCFS, G01, G02, G03, RANDOM, and SOP) for order batching, and S-Shape and L-Gap for order picking. The simulations considered a list of 20 to 100 orders or carts with a capacity of 30 to 75 order items. As a result, ANOVA analysis demonstrates the significance of order batching and picking algorithms, number of orders and cart capacity. The order batching algorithms that provide minimum distances in these experiments are G03 and RANDOM, and for order picking, LGAP algorithm is most effective. The number of cross aisles in configuration presented in this research that yields the minimum distances is 26; however, this is not conclusive to ensure that minimum distances will always be achieved with this number of transverse aisles.
